Outstanding Performances by Qualifiers
Among the qualifiers, Zeynep Sonmez has stood out by defeating Anna Bondar in a commanding straight-set victory. This win secured her a place in the round of 32, making her a player to watch. Sonmez expressed her satisfaction with her performance, attributing her success to the prior preparation of playing three matches in the qualifiers. This experience allowed her to adapt to the court and weather conditions.

At just 23 years old, Sonmez made history as the first Turkish woman to win matches in the Australian Open main draw during the Open era. She achieved this remarkable feat by defeating the 11th seed, Ekaterina Alexandrova, in a hard-fought three-set match. As she prepares to face Yulia Putintseva in the upcoming round, Sonmez can anticipate a lively atmosphere, supported by her enthusiastic Turkish fans.
Fan Support and Atmosphere
Sonmez shared her feelings about the vibrant support from her fellow countrymen during her matches. The atmosphere, especially on Court 7, felt like home, invigorating her performance on the court.
Great Britain’s Arthur Fery also demonstrated resilience by overcoming the 20th seed, Flavio Cobolli, at John Cain Arena. While Fery’s skill was crucial to his victory, Cobolli’s unexpected stomach pain affected his performance in the match.
